Facile Synthesis of Bis(indolyl)methanes catalyzed by Ferric Dodecyl Sulfonate [Fe(DS)3] in Water at Room Temperature

&
Pages 1291-1298 | Received 10 May 2007, Published online: 17 Apr 2008
 

Abstract

Ferric dodecyl sulfonate [Fe(DS)3] is easily prepared and can be used as a Lewis acid surfactant catalyst in water to conduct the highly efficient electrophilic substitution reaction of indoles with aliphatic or aromatic aldehydes at room temperature.
